WebAug 20, 2014 · Hyper--Melaninization: Clownfish with dark pigmentation resulting from a reaction to stings from a coral or anemone. This usually poses no notable problem to the clownfish other than cosmetic. The melanin [pigment] darkens as it reacts to the nematocysts (sting cells) of the anemone or coral. One of the first marine aquarium fish to be successfully bred in captivity, early success with their captive … WebNov 12, 2024 · The Red Sea Clownfish lives from the shallows down to 30 m, generally living in pairs in association with an anemeone. The tentacles of the anemone protect the clownfish from predators. At first contact with the anenome the clownfish jerks back, but gradually its mucus coating gives it immunity to the anemone's stinging nematocysts.
